Is Adolescence Primarily based on a True Story?

Adolescence isn’t based mostly on a specific real-life crime. Stephen knowledgeable Netflix’s Tudum that he was impressed to work on the script when he heard about an incident within the U.Okay. when a “younger boy [allegedly] stabbed a lady.”

“It shocked me,” Stephen elaborated, including, “I used to be considering, ‘What’s happening? What’s taking place in society the place a boy stabs a lady to loss of life? What’s the inciting incident right here?’ After which it occurred once more, and it occurred once more, and it occurred once more. I actually simply wished to shine a light-weight on it, and ask, ‘Why is that this taking place right now? What’s happening? How have we come to this?’”

Co-creator Jack added that he, Stephen and director Philip Barantini had been fascinated by the idea of male rage, and so they started “questioning with some depth” who they had been as males. “That could be a journey I’ve by no means gone on as a author earlier than, and it scared me and excited me as a result of it felt like we had one thing to say,” Jack identified.

Adolescence‘s Ending Defined

The ultimate episode of Adolescence ends with Jamie calling his dad to disclose he’s altering his plea to responsible. Stephen’s character, Eddie Miller, then displays on how his parenting performed a task in his son’s life. He and Jamie’s mom, Manda Miller (performed by Christine Tremarco) focus on the warning indicators they witnessed with Jamie, together with the teenager staying up late at evening on his laptop.

The ultimate moments of episode 4 present Eddie sobbing in Jamie’s room and tucking in his stuffed animal underneath the covers earlier than apologizing to Jamie, absolutely accepting his destiny.

“I’m sorry, son,” Eddie says by way of tears, earlier than admitting, “I ought to have completed higher.”
